makeWellBehaved: Make mutation model well behaved

View source: R/makeWellBehaved.R

makeWellBehavedR Documentation

Make mutation model well behaved

Description

Replace q_ij by min(q_ij,p_j)

Usage

makeWellBehaved(Q, afreq)

Arguments

Q

a mutation model

afreq

A numeric vector of allele frequencies.

Value

A reversible stepwise mutation model.

Author(s)

Thore Egeland.

Examples

## Not run: 
# Not well behaved:
p = c(0.4, 0.6)
Q = stepwiseReversible(alleles = 1:2, afreq = p, rate = 0.6, range = 0.1)
makeWellBehaved(Q, afreq = p)

## End(Not run)

thoree/mut2 documentation built on May 16, 2023, 7:56 p.m.